admin管理员组文章数量:1516870
电脑问答:深度解析硬件与软件的关系与优化技巧
引言
电脑作为现代生活和工作的基础工具,其性能尤为重要。用户常常面临硬件配置与软件优化的疑问,为此本篇文章将深入探讨硬件组件的作用,软件在系统中的作用,以及如何调优以提升整体性能。无论是硬件升级还是系统配置,理解其背后的原理都能帮助用户做出更合理的选择,获得更佳的使用体验。
硬件、软件的基本关系与原理
电脑硬件是物理实体,包括中央处理器(CPU)、内存(RAM)、存储设备(硬盘或固态硬盘)、显卡、主板、电源等;软件则是运行在硬件上的操作系统、应用程序、驱动程序等。二者相辅相成,硬件提供基础资源,软件合理调用硬件使系统流畅运行。
理解硬件与软件的关系关键在于,硬件好不代表系统就一定快,软件优化同样重要。比如,配备高端显卡如果驱动没更新或软件优化不足,也可能导致性能瓶颈。
硬件配置的优化建议
-
处理器(CPU)
一款高性能的处理器能显著提升任务处理速度,但需结合多核技术和任务类型合理选择。多核CPU在多线程和复杂运算中表现优异。 -
内存(RAM)
足够的内存能避免频繁的虚拟内存交换,提高响应速度。对于日常办公和轻度游戏,8GB已基本满足;专业设计和视频剪辑推荐16GB或更高。 -
存储设备
选择固态硬盘(SSD)可以大幅提升系统启动及程序加载速度。定期清理存储空间,避免碎片积累影响读写效率。 -
显卡
对于游戏和图形设计,显卡作用至关重要。不同级别的显卡适应不同需求,注意与屏幕分辨率匹配。 -
电源与散热
可靠的电源和良好的散热系统能保证硬件稳定工作,避免性能受损或硬件损坏。
软件层面的优化技巧
操作系统调优
合理配置虚拟内存,关闭无用的启动项和后台程序,可以释放资源。定期清理磁盘,更新系统补丁,确保安全和性能。
驱动程序的更新
最新的驱动程序能解决兼容性问题和性能瓶颈,尤其是显卡、芯片组等核心硬件。推荐使用官方渠道下载安装。
应用软件的优化
关闭背景占用资源较高的应用,合理使用多线程和多进程技术,提升软件处理效率。对于开发环境,可调节优先级或分配核心,提高响应速度。
系统监控与性能调试
利用任务管理器、性能监视器等内置工具,实时追踪CPU、内存、硬盘和网络使用情况。发现瓶颈时,有针对性地调整配置。
例如,若发现硬盘瓶颈,可考虑使用SSD替换传统硬盘。若CPU持续高负载,检查后台进程或优化软件算法。定期进行磁盘碎片整理(对机械硬盘有效),确保存储效率。
未来发展趋势——智能调优与自动化管理
科技不断进步,未来通过人工智能实现系统的智能调优将成为趋势。系统自行检测硬件状态、预测性能瓶颈并建议优化方案,提升用户体验。
此外,虚拟化技术和云计算将使硬件资源利用更加弹性,软件架构也趋向微服务化,提升系统整体性能和稳定性。
硬件与软件的协同运作实例
某编程工作站通过增设高速SSD、升级内存到32GB,配合优化的开发环境和低延迟网络,实现了编译时间从分钟缩短至数十秒,整体响应提升明显。这种硬件与软件协同优于单一硬件升级,展示了二者深度结合的优势。
结语
优化电脑性能是一项系统工程,涉及硬件合理配置、软件调优与系统监控。持续关注最新技术趋势,保持硬件与软件的平衡,才能实现性能的最大化,享受流畅高效的数字生活体验。
示例:使用Python监控系统资源
import psutil
def system_monitor():
cpu = psutil.cpu_percent(interval=1)
mem = psutil.virtual_memory()
disk = psutil.disk_usage('/')
print(f'CPU利用率:{cpu}%')
print(f'内存使用:{mem.percent}%')
print(f'硬盘使用:{disk.percent}%')
if __name__ == "__mn__":
system_monitor()
---
---版权声明:本文标题:电脑问答:深度解析硬件与软件的关系与优化技巧 内容由网友自发贡献,该文观点仅代表作者本人, 转载请联系作者并注明出处:https://www.betaflare.com/biancheng/1765986019a3247268.html, 本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,一经查实,本站将立刻删除。


发表评论